首页 > 开发工具 > VSCode > 正文

一篇文章读懂VS Code的核心概念

P粉986688829
发布: 2025-11-25 16:01:03
原创
172人浏览过
理解VS Code需掌握四大核心:工作区实现多项目统一管理,设置系统支持层级化配置,扩展机制提供功能延展,集成终端与任务系统打通开发闭环。

vs code 不是传统意义上的编辑器,而是一个为开发者量身打造的现代化开发环境。要真正用好它,不能只靠点点按钮或装几个插件,得先理解它的核心设计逻辑。下面从几个关键概念入手,帮你理清 vs code 的运作方式。

工作区(Workspace):项目管理的基本单位

很多人打开 VS Code 就直接编辑文件,但真正高效的工作是从“工作区”开始的。工作区不只是一个文件夹,它可以包含多个项目目录,还能保存专属的设置和调试配置。

当你打开一个文件夹时,VS Code 默认以该文件夹作为工作区。如果项目涉及前后端分离,你可以通过“文件 > 将文件夹添加到工作区”把多个目录纳入同一个窗口管理。保存后生成 .code-workspace 文件,团队共享这份配置就能保持开发环境一致。

  • 单文件夹项目:普通打开即可
  • 多模块项目:建议创建多根工作区
  • 不同项目用不同工作区,避免设置冲突

设置(Settings):分层控制的灵活性

VS Code 的设置系统采用三层结构:默认设置、用户设置、工作区设置。优先级逐层覆盖,越靠近项目的层级权重越高。

用户设置适用于所有项目,比如字体大小、主题颜色;工作区设置则针对当前项目,例如指定 Node.js 版本、启用特定扩展。这种设计让你既能统一偏好,又能灵活适配不同技术

通过 Ctrl+, 打开设置界面,切换“用户”和“工作区”标签即可分别配置。高级用户还可以直接编辑 settings.json 文件,实现更精细的控制。

扩展(Extensions):功能延展的核心机制

VS Code 本身很轻,真正的强大来自扩展生态。扩展不仅能增加语法高亮、代码补全,还能集成调试器、版本控制工具甚至整个运行时环境。

安装扩展非常简单,在侧边栏点击扩展图标搜索即可。但要注意,并非越多越好。低质量或冲突的扩展会拖慢启动速度,甚至导致崩溃。

Levity
Levity

AI帮你自动化日常任务

Levity 206
查看详情 Levity
  • 按需安装,优先选择官方或高评分插件
  • 使用扩展包(Extension Pack)一键配置常用组合
  • 禁用不用的扩展,保持运行效率

像 Python、TypeScript 这类语言支持,其实是通过扩展实现的。理解这一点,你就明白为什么刚装完语言插件后才能获得智能提示。

集成终端与任务系统:打通开发闭环

写代码只是开发的一环,运行、测试、构建同样重要。VS Code 内置了终端(Terminal),可以直接在编辑器底部执行命令行操作,无需切换窗口。

更进一步的是任务系统(Tasks)。你可以定义预设任务,比如“编译 TypeScript”或“运行单元测试”,然后通过菜单或快捷键一键触发。这些任务可以关联到外部工具,输出结果还能被解析并跳转到错误位置。

结合调试器(Debug),你能在同一界面完成编码、构建、运行、排查全流程,极大提升专注力。

基本上就这些。掌握工作区、设置、扩展和任务这几个核心概念,你就不是在“使用”VS Code,而是在“驾驭”它。工具的设计逻辑清楚了,剩下的就是根据项目需要去组合和优化。不复杂,但容易忽略。

以上就是一篇文章读懂VS Code的核心概念的详细内容,更多请关注php中文网其它相关文章!

最佳 Windows 性能的顶级免费优化软件
最佳 Windows 性能的顶级免费优化软件

每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。

下载
来源:php中文网
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
最新问题
开源免费商场系统广告
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号